
Sitcom veteran and heart-throb John Stamos has landed a season-long arc on the USA Network series Necessary Roughness. This role is coming on the heels of Stamos’ recent recurring roles on Glee and The New Normal, as well as the announcement that Stamos will star in the new upcoming NBC drama pilot I Am Victor.
Stamos will play the role of Connor McClane, the entrepreneur and founder of a sports and entertainment management company called V3. His company is incredibly successful and has turned into a global empire. Connor is eager to get Dr. Dani (Callie Thorne) on its payroll, impressed by her success after working with Terrance King (Mehcad Brooks). In a statement released by the USA Network, Stamos’ character will “Do whatever it takes to get Dani into the V3 family.” It sounds like there is the possibility of more than just a business arrangement between Connor and Dani in the works.
The series, which was almost cancelled back in January, has been renewed for a shorter 10-episode third season. Not surprisingly, Necessary Roughness will be going through some changes before it returns with its third season this summer. USA Co-President Jeff Wachtel says “They're really embracing blowing it out in the third season. We're really going to swing for the fences with that type of storytelling on Necessary."
